Make sure your lavatory is well-ventilated if you want to keep mildew and mold at bay. Allergens are most commonly found in warm, moist areas. Therefore, hang up wet washcloths and towels and turn on fan when showering. If your house is not equipped with a fan, open a window to get some air moving.

If you can, do not have carpet or rugs in your house. Allergens like pollen, dust, dander, and mites tend to stick in carpet fibers, and people who are sensitive to them will find it is practically impossible to get rid of them entirely. Floors that can be efficiently cleaned are far more suitable when you have allergies.

Are you aware of the fact that your body itself may actually cause allergic episodes? Believe it or not, it’s true! Throughout the day, pollen and dust in the air gets onto your clothing, hair and body. If you settle into bed with all those allergens still attached to you, then night-time discomfort can result. Have a shower and grab some fresh clothes before you head off to bed each night.

If you’re a pet owner that suffers from allergies all the time, you may be experiencing allergies due to your pet. To find out whether or not your pet is the culprit, visit your doctor and ask to have a pet dander allergy test. You will not necessarily need to find a new home for your pet, though you might need to alter your arrangements somewhat.
